Shunned by the rest of the Legions after the destruction of their home world, the Night Lords have fought without their disgraced primarch Konrad Curze for many years. But now the self-proclaimed ‘Night Haunter’ has returned and will lead them to the backwater world of Isstvan V, where a great treachery is unfolding, and the grim legionaries of First Claw will soon be forced to embrace their dark destiny.
4/5

Le style de l'auteur nous captive. Bien que courte, cette nouvelle arrive à nous plonger dans les ténèbres des Night Lords avec une facilité déconcertante. Il ne s'y passe pas grand chose, et pourtant l'ambiance est dépeinte avec brio. Elle vous donnera envie d'en lire plus...

In the 41st millennium, the past can be even more deadly than the present. The Horus Heresy may have happened ten thousand years ago, but the dark shadows of its history can never be fully excised. Inquisitor Eisenhorn travels to the world of Pallik, where, it is rumoured, a rare and ancient artefact from those terrible times has been put on sale. Eisenhorn and his team are plunged into a deadly game of cross and double-cross in a brand new story by the master of action-adventure fiction.
4.5/5

The Keeler Image est une nouvelle que nous n'attentions pas mais qui ravira les fans de la première heure. Cependant elle aura un intérêt très limité pour les hérétiques fuyant comme la peste le contenu sur l'Inquisition. À vous de choisir, pour ma part Eisenhorn aura toujours mon av...
